Growing Up


Listen Later

How do the stories we inherit, and the ones we tell, shape our journey from childhood into adulthood? In Radio 4's weekly discussion programme, Naomi Alderman and guests examine the shifting boundaries between youth, experience and societal expectation across memoir, history and fiction.

Booker Prize winner David Szalay talks about Flesh, his stark, propulsive novel tracing one boy’s path from adolescence in Hungary to adulthood among London’s super rich, exploring desire, power, class and the ways childhood experiences reverberate across a lifetime.

Filmmaker and writer Penny Woolcock grew up in a British enclave in Argentina. Her coming-of-age memoir, The Man Who Gave Me a Biscuit: Love and Death in Argentina, interweaves memories of teenage rebellion with the buried histories of genocide, authoritarianism and a society built on repression.

The historian Laura Tisdall discusses We Have Come to Be Destroyed, her vivid account of growing up in Cold War Britain, revealing how young people challenged the world adults made for them - from activism and anxieties about the future, to everyday resistance against narrow expectations.
